Заменить текст столбца на основе значений из другой таблицы Excel - PullRequest
0 голосов
/ 28 февраля 2019

Как я могу сформулировать, чтобы изменить текст в столбце на основе предопределенных значений из другой таблицы?

  A   |  B     |  C
Office| Initial| Value
------|--------|-------
W     |  E     | Excel
E     |  Po    | Powerpoint
Po    |  W     | Word

Как мне сформулировать Column A, что если я напишу W, это будетавтоматически заменить на Word, если я напишу Po, он будет заменен на 'Powerpoint`?

Я некоторое время искал, но не мог найти правильный способ его сформулировать.Как я могу написать функцию для него?

1 Ответ

0 голосов
/ 28 февраля 2019

Если вы хотите найти частичное совпадение вашей записи в A1 со значениями в столбце C и показом результата в столбце B, используйте эту формулу в столбце B:

=INDIRECT(ADDRESS(MATCH($A1&"*",$C:$C,0),COLUMN($C$1)))

(Примечание: Iиспользовал «COLUMN (C1)» вместо «3», чтобы выдержать движение, копирование, вставку столбцов и т.1007 *

Результат:

  A  |B          |C
1 Po |Powerpoint |Excel
2 Ph |Photoshop  |Powerpoint
3 P  |Powerpoint |Word
4 Ex |Excel      |Photoshop
5 Ed |#N/A       |
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...